Jubilee Hair Salon is located near Tottenham Court Road station in the Korean district of London opposite the food store. The place is home to great Japanese and Korean stylists. My stylist was Yoshie, whose name I got from an online review. She listened to what I wanted, gave me her own opinions on whether this would suit my face shape, and generally played it safe, letting me know whenever she was about to do anything, as opposed to just chopping. I also got reassurance as I was very worried about getting the fringe I wanted to try, having not had one for about 13 years. Seeing about 12 inches of hair fall in front of my eyes freaked me out a but she did it so fast I didn't have time to dwell on it much, thinking 'well that's done, not much I can do now!'. I also had about 3 inches cut off the rest.

For those of you interested, the address is: 28 Denmark Street, WC2H 8NP. Telephone number 020 7240 5999



It doesn't look like much from the outside, or even inside rather (nothing like a top London salon if I were to compare to other places I've been in the past), but don't let this fool you. I was also told that it had recently been refurbished.

I ended up paying £45 because of the length of my hair. Other reviews which I have seen online put the average price for women between £29 and £39. I was also told by my sister later on that they do student discounts. Compared to places like Toni & Guy its a bargain! I'd been quoted in the £30s on my appointment-making visit so was a little dissapointed but overall happy with the result, speed, and friendliness of employees.
